How they compare

Trinidad and Tobago currently reports 98.1% against 98.0% in Argentina, a difference of 0.1%.

The two have swapped places 4 times across 7 shared years of data; in 2000 it was Trinidad and Tobago ahead.

Argentina ranks 36th and Trinidad and Tobago ranks 35th of 164 countries.

Across the 2 decades both report, Argentina averaged higher in 1 and Trinidad and Tobago in 1.

Persistence to grade 5 (percentage of cohort reaching grade 5) is the share of children enrolled in the first grade of primary school who eventually reach grade 5. The estimate is based on the reconstructed cohort method.
